Former Maple Leafs captain John Tavares has shared some intriguing comments about his new upcoming contract in Toronto.

All season long, one of the more interesting storylines to follow in Toronto has been the contract status of John Tavares and what a new deal might look like for the former Leafs captain.
Despite reports suggesting that neither Tavares nor Mitch Marner are likely to extend their contracts during this season, some comments made by Tavares this week suggest something to the contrary. Tavares told the media that he would like to get something done before the trade deadline on March 7th, if possible. He also reiterated his desire to remain a Leaf.
"If we have the opportunity to get it done, I'd love to do that. If not, when that time comes, we'll get there just looking forward to continuing my journey here as a Leaf, and obviously want it to continue past this season"
Tavares has long been a vocal supporter and believer of this Maple Leafs team, even after stepping down and offering up the captaincy to Auston Matthews. He bleeds blue and white and clearly wants to retire with the Leafs, embodying the exact type of player you want in your organization.
In an effort to extend his already illustrious career, Tavares has made changes to his off-ice routines. His efforts are clearly paying off, as he has been rejuvenated this season, posting 48 points in 50 games at 34 years old.
Tavares' impressive play has led to some outrage about his exclusion from Team Canada for the 4 Nations Face-Off in favour of names like Seth Jarvis, Travis Konecny, Anthony Cirelli and Brandon Hagel -- a decision that highlights how many still believe he has plenty to offer.
At this point, it seems Tavares may be willing to take a discounted rate to stay in Toronto. If he does, it makes sense for him to return to the Leafs. While he currently serves as the second-line center, the Maple Leafs will continue their search for someone to fill that role, allowing Tavares to eventually transition into a more supportive role to maintain his longevity.
One thing is certain: Tavares wants to remain a Maple Leaf for as long as possible, and he'd like a deal to be done as quickly as the two sides can hash it out.
